
There is not always time for a tournament lasting several hours. Sometimes you just want to sit down and play for a few minutes. That’s what Ignition Poker Sit and Go are for: tournaments that start when players are ready, with no fixed start time, and in most cases last no more than 60 minutes.

How to participate in Ignition Poker Sit and Go?
The player enters the Ignition Poker lobby, chooses their format, pays the buy-in, and waits for the table to fill. There are no scheduled sessions, no flights, no need to occupy the afternoon. It’s pure poker, available at any time of day.

What makes Ignition Poker Sit and Go attractive is the variety of formats available:

- The Knockout rewards each elimination with extra money, turning every hand into a double opportunity.
- The Turbo and Hyper Turbo are the fastest formats: blinds increase quickly and there is a result in just a few minutes.
- The Double Up and Triple Up are for those who prefer clear goals: survive half or a third of the field and double or triple the investment.
- Satellites are the most economical route to secure a spot in bigger events. Ideal for those aiming for larger tournaments.
Other formats in this modality
There are also Multitable options, where tables are reorganized as players are eliminated, and a Beginner category for those just starting in the format, with more accessible prizes and a higher number of payouts.
Within the Sit and Go category also live the Jackpot Sit and Go, the most explosive format in the family: three players, 300-chip stack, blinds increase every 3 minutes, and a prize revealed at the start of the game. With a buy-in of US$0.50 prizes can reach US$5,000, and with US$2 the ceiling rises to US$10,000.
